Side Dish Recipe ∼ Island Okras

In Barbados okras are plentiful! My family eats them almost weekly and this is our favorite way of cooking them! One of the greatest things about this dish is that the okras are not slimy or mushy, and the lime gives it a great kick! I often serve this dish with a curry... but it is a great side dish for most meals!!!

Island Okras
Prep:10m
Cook:15m
Ready in:25m
Serving:6 servings

Ingredients

  • 3 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 large onion, thinly sliced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 4 cups fresh okra, ends trimmed and halved lengthwise
  • salt to taste
  • ground black pepper to taste
  • 1 lime, juiced

Cooking Directions

  1. Heat the ol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Stir in the onion and garlic; cook and stir until the onion has softened and turned translucent, about 5 minutes.
  2. Add the okra, salt, and pepper. Increase the heat to high; cook and stir until the okra begins to brown, about 10 minutes. Pour the lime juice over the okra and continue cooking for 2 minutes.
